Happiness Management: A Pillar of Sustainability and Organizational Communication in Industry 4.0

What is this article about?

This editorial introduces the concept of happiness management as a key strategy to improve organizational communication, governance, and sustainability in the context of Industry 4.0. According to Ravina-Ripoll, Romero-Rodríguez, and Ahumada-Tello, this human-centered approach promotes subjective wellbeing and aligns with modern productivity, leadership, and digital transformation goals.


Why is it important?

This article explains that focusing on employee happiness is no longer a utopian idea but a strategic tool for corporate and public governance. It enhances human capital, fosters innovation, and supports psychosocial wellbeing—factors that are critical amid technological disruption and post-pandemic recovery.


Key Insights from the Editorial

1. Happiness as a governance strategy

  • Wellbeing boosts productivity and public trust.

  • Happiness indices can inform policy and performance metrics.

2. Corporate implications

  • Organizations must integrate emotional and physical health into their management structures.

  • Workplace happiness is shaped by engagement, academic satisfaction, and organizational climate.

3. Post-pandemic challenges

  • COVID-19 amplified emotional strain and social vulnerability.

  • Social media signals can track public happiness and guide interventions.

FAQs

Q: What is happiness management?
A: It is a governance strategy that integrates emotional wellbeing and subjective happiness into corporate and public policies.

Q: How does it impact organizations?
A: It improves productivity, employee satisfaction, and stakeholder engagement, especially in the digital transformation era.

Q: What disciplines intersect in this field?
A: Communication, psychology, public policy, HR management, and digital innovation.

Q: Is there empirical support?
A: Yes. The editorial includes studies with SEM models, ANOVA, and regression analysis across diverse sectors.

Ravina Ripoll, R., Romero-Rodríguez, L.M., & Ahumada-Tello, E. (2022). Guest editorial: Happiness management: key factors for sustainability and organizational communication in the age of Industry 4.0. Corporate Governance, 22(3), 449-457. https://doi.org/10.1108/CG-05-2022-576
